Understanding Family Law
Family law involves many legal matters that affect families, such as divorce, child custody, and property settlements. Knowing what to expect in these cases can help you understand your rights and responsibilities.
Definition of Family Law
Family law deals with issues related to family relationships. This includes divorce, child support, and spousal maintenance. Lawyers in this field help clients navigate the often complex and emotional aspects of family disputes. They also provide legal advice to protect their client’s interests.
Family law is not just about ending relationships, it also covers pre-nuptial agreements and adoption. In addition, family lawyers work to ensure fair outcomes for all parties involved. This requires a blend of legal expertise and empathy to handle sensitive situations.
Common Family Law Cases
There are several types of cases that family lawyers handle regularly. These include divorce and separation, which require decisions on property division and financial support. Child custody cases determine living arrangements and visitation rights for children.
Spousal support or maintenance is another common issue, where one partner may be required to provide financial support to the other. Adoption and guardianship are also handled under family law, ensuring legal rights for both children and parents.
Family law cases can be stressful and emotional. A good family lawyer provides support throughout the legal process, offering advice and representation to achieve the best possible outcome. By understanding these common cases, clients can better prepare for legal proceedings.

Questions to Ask Your Family Lawyer
When meeting with a potential family lawyer, ask about their experience in handling cases similar to yours. For example, how long they have been practicing family law and their success rate in such cases.
Inquire about their approach to resolving family law issues. A professional lawyer should be able to explain their strategy clearly and how they plan to handle your specific case. For instance, do they prefer mediation or litigation?
Discuss the lawyer’s availability and communication. It’s important to know how often you can expect updates and how accessible they will be.
Finally, ask about their fees and payment options. Understanding the costs from the outset helps in planning and avoiding unexpected expenses.
